Nanophotonics Engineer: Professionals in this role focus on designing and developing nanoscale photonic devices, using advanced plasmonic techniques.
Plasmonic Device Scientist: These experts research, design, and test plasmonic devices and systems that manipulate light at the nanoscale.
Research Scientist (Plasmonics): These professionals conduct research in the field of Plasmonics, advancing the understanding and development of plasmonic devices.
Thin Film Physicist: Thin Film Physicists specialize in the study of thin films, which can involve plasmonic materials and their unique properties.
Plasmonics R&D Engineer: Engineers in this role focus on researching and developing new plasmonic technologies and techniques, driving innovation in the field.
